Study how heart cell connections differ in inherited rhythm problems
Part of Genetic & congenital, Heart & circulation clinical trials.
This study looks at how proteins that connect heart cells are distributed in people with inherited heart rhythm disorders (and some family members who may carry the gene). It aims to better understand the biology behind these conditions, which may help improve risk assessment and future care.

Who can take part
- You are 18 years or older
- You (or a close relative) are being seen for an inherited heart rhythm problem at St. George’s inherited heart clinic
- You may be a person with symptoms, or a family member who carries the gene but may not have symptoms yet
- You can have any treatment plan (medicines, devices, or procedures) and still join
- You are able and willing to sign informed consent for the study
- You can explain the study in English, or you have a translator available if needed
